The 25th Eurasia Window, 16th Eurasia Door, and 14th Eurasia Glass Fairs have officially opened their doors at the T眉yap Fair and Congress Center in located Istanbul, showcasing the latest products and technologies in the industry.

Over 60,000 visitors are expected to attend these co-locating trade events.

Istanbul鈥檚 T眉yap Fair and Congress Center is once again hosting one of the most important events in the construction industry. The 25th Eurasia Window, 16th Eurasia Door, and 14th Eurasia Glass Fairs are running concurrently from November 16th to 19th , 2024, bringing together professionals from across the industries.

The Heart of the Industry is in Istanbul
Celebrating its 25th edition, the Eurasia Window Fair features a broad spectrum of products, from aluminum window and facade systems to shading solutions. Among the highlights isthe 鈥淎luminum Special Section,鈥 showcasing companies from T眉rkiye and the Eurasian region offering aluminum window and facade systems. Meanwhile, the 鈥淪hading Special Section鈥 presents innovative solutions such as awnings, pergolas, and glass balcony systems. Additionally, visitors can explore cutting-edge window profiles, insulation solutions, and profile machinery, catering to the interests of industry professionals.

Innovation in the Door Industry
Now in its 16th year, the Eurasia Door Fair introduces visitors to a range of innovative products, including door models, accessories, partition solutions, and panels. The event serves as a key platform, not only for T眉rkiye but for a wide region extending from Europe to the Middle East and North Africa. Local manufacturersleverage this opportunity to showcase their products and connect with target markets.

Emerging Technologies and Trends in the Glass Industry
The 14th Eurasia Glass Fair gathers professionals from the glass industry, architecture, and interior design sectors. The exhibition features a diverse range of products, from glass production and processing technologies to innovative solutions. Attendees can explore the latest trends in glass decoration, insulation, fa莽ade systems, and more.

Organized by RX T眉yap in Collaboration with Industry Associations
The fairs are organized by RX T眉yap in partnership with key associations, including P脺KAD (Window and Door Sector Association), P脺KAB (Window Producers Quality League Association), and GALS陌AD (Entrepreneur Aluminum Industrialists and Businesspeople Association). These collaborations bring together prominent players in the construction industry, fostering an environment to showcase the latest products and technologies.

During his opening speech, RX T眉yap General Manager Berkan 脰ner emphasized the fairs' contributions to the sector and extended his gratitude to the partnering associations. 脰ner stated: 鈥淲elcome to the 25th Eurasia Window, 16th Eurasia Door, and 14th Eurasia Glass Fairs, where we unite three pivotal branches of the construction industry. This year, our fairs open with record participation. Thanks to year-long promotional efforts and international connections, over 660 companies and representatives from 22 countries are participating. According to our online registration data, we expect more than 60,000 visitors, including over 13,000 from abroad. This robust turnout reaffirms our commitment to creating a regional and global hub for the construction industry.鈥
